How do I resolve a malfunctioning navigation system in my 2023 Toyota Highlander?

Symptoms

  • •No GPS signal or 'Searching for GPS' message
  • •Navigation maps not loading or outdated
  • •System freezing or crashing
  • •Incorrect directions or map errors
  • •Inability to input destinations or access navigation menus

Troubleshooting and Repairing a Malfunctioning Navigation System in a 2023 Toyota Highlander

Tools Required

  • OBD-II Scanner (optional, for checking any error codes)
  • Flathead and Phillips screwdrivers
  • Trim removal tools
  • Laptop with internet access (for software updates)
  • USB Drive (if needed for map updates)
  • Multimeter (for testing electrical connections)

Repair Instructions

Step 1: Update Navigation Software

  1. Prepare for Update:

    • Visit the official Toyota website or navigation software provider to check for updates.
    • Download the latest software to a USB drive.
  2. Install Update:

    • Insert the USB drive into the USB port of the Highlander.
    • Turn on the vehicle.
    • From the navigation system menu, look for an “Update” option.
    •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the update.

Step 2: Reset the Navigation System

  1. Factory Reset:
    • Navigate to the settings menu on the navigation system.
    • Look for “System” or “Reset” options.
    • Select “Factory Reset” or “Restore Default Settings.”
    • Confirm the action. This will erase all saved data, so ensure you back up important addresses.

Step 3: Checking Hardware Connections

  1. Remove Trim Panels:

    • Use trim removal tools to carefully remove the panels surrounding the navigation system.
  2. Access the Navigation Unit:

    • Unscrew and pull out the navigation unit from the dashboard.
  3. Inspect Connections:

    • Check all wiring harnesses for secure connections.
    • Look for any visible damage or corrosion.
    • If necessary, use a multimeter to check for continuity in the wires.
  4. Reinstall the Navigation Unit:

    • Reattach all connectors securely.
    • Slide the navigation unit back into place and screw it in.
    • Replace the trim panels.

Step 4: Consult Dealership or Professional Help

If the issue persists after performing the above steps, it may require professional diagnostics. Contact your local Toyota dealership or a certified technician for further assistance, especially if the vehicle is still under warranty.
